Output 8fc2439a80edc4b235987e910bd73d0ec981f45a266d861d72106b6c1038a7e8:1

value
2351761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d746ecb317ff80067f8e25e8dc1249ef5c10231e OP_EQUAL
address
3MKJAiSyFLAauydNsGH4TXFLEjw37LiN8A
transaction
8fc2439a80edc4b235987e910bd73d0ec981f45a266d861d72106b6c1038a7e8
spent
true